What is Fake Currency?

Fake currency, frequently referred to as counterfeit money, is currency produced without the legal sanction of the state or government. The primary purpose of counterfeiting is to deceive people into thinking that the phony notes are authentic, allowing the counterfeiters to profit illegally. Counterfeit currency can differ in quality, ranging from poorly made reproductions to highly sophisticated forgeries that are almost equivalent from real money.

Factors Behind Counterfeiting

Counterfeiting is a complex and multi-faceted concern. A number of inspirations drive people and companies to engage in the production of phony currency:

  1. Financial Gain: The most simple factor is the potential for considerable profit without the effort of genuine work.
  2. Criminal Activity: Counterfeit currency is often used to fund other illegal activities, such as drug trafficking or arranged criminal activity.
  3. Financial Disruption: Some counterfeiters intend to hurt economies by devaluing currency and instigating inflation.
  4. Creative Expression: In some uncommon cases, individuals might produce fake currency as a form of art work or social commentary, although legality stays a concern.

Obstacles in Counterfeiting

Regardless of improvements in printing technology, counterfeiters face a myriad of obstacles:

  • Detection Technology: Financial institutions and police use advanced technology, such as ultraviolet light and watermarks, to recognize fake bills.
  • Rigorous Regulations: Governments worldwide have actually enacted rigid laws and policies, making counterfeiting increasingly risky.
  • Public Awareness: Increased awareness about counterfeit currency among the general public has further made complex the efforts of counterfeiters.

Q4: What are the signs of counterfeit currency?

A: Some indications include:

  • Poor print quality
  • Irregular colors
  • Absence of security features, such as watermarks or security threads
  • Inaccurate dimensions compared to real notes
